Crafting a Resilient Portfolio: Strategies for Uncertain Times

In turbulent market conditions, building a resilient portfolio is paramount. A well-diversified strategy encompasses allocating assets across various asset classes such as shares, bonds, real estate, and commodities. This diversification mitigates risk by ensuring that if one asset class underperforms, others may compensate the losses. It's also crucial to regularly review and rebalance your portfolio to maintain your desired asset allocation.

Furthermore, utilizing a long-term investment horizon can help weather short-term market volatility. Remember that markets tend to recover over time, and persistence is key.

Explore alternative investments like gold or precious metals which may act as a safe haven against inflation during uncertain periods. Lastly, don't hesitate to seek advice a qualified financial advisor who can provide customized guidance based on your risk tolerance.
